General Description:

Reporting to the Senior Manager, Accounting, the Accounting Manager owns key components of BeOne Medicines’ daily accounting operations, general ledger governance, fixed asset accounting, and month- and quarter-end close execution. This hands-on leadership role partners closely with internal finance stakeholders, shared service teams, external auditors, and tax advisors to ensure accurate financial reporting, effective controls, and continuous improvement across core accounting processes. The successful candidate will bring strong technical accounting knowledge, sound judgment, clear communication, and the ability to manage priorities, deadlines, and cross-functional projects in a fast-paced environment.

Essential Functions of the Job:

  • Lead the monthly and quarterly close process, including close calendar management, journal entry review, account reconciliation oversight, and financial statement preparation.
  • Manage general ledger accounting operations, fixed asset responsibilities, and related accounting activities to ensure transactions are recorded accurately, completely, and in accordance with US GAAP.
  • Maintain and strengthen accounting policies, procedures, and internal controls, with particular emphasis on SOX 404 compliance, control documentation, and audit readiness.
  • Coordinate with purchasing, accounts payable, payroll, tax, internal stakeholders, shared service teams, and external auditors to support accurate reporting, tax return preparation, quarterly reviews, and annual audits.
  • Identify and implement process, system, and automation improvements that increase efficiency, improve control effectiveness, and support evolving business needs.
  • Lead or support cross-functional accounting initiatives and other finance projects as business priorities require.

Supervisory Responsibilities:  

  • Provide functional oversight to shared service accounting resources responsible for cash reconciliation and related accounting activities.

Education Required:

  • Bachelor’s degree, preferably in Accounting or Finance; CPA a plus.

Qualifications:    

  • Bachelor’s degree, preferably in Accounting or Finance 5+ years of accounting operations experience required; biotechnology industry experience preferred.
  • Demonstrated ability to think strategically about the role of finance and accounting in supporting the company’s strategy.
  • Strong knowledge of US GAAP and SOX 404 compliance.
  • Demonstrated experience managing financial close activities, audits, and financial statement preparation.
  • Proven success working well under pressure, highly organized with the ability to meet deadlines.
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ced and collaborative environment and adjust to changing priorities.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ills with the ability to partner effectively across functions.
  • High attention to detail and strong organizational skills.

Computer Skills:   

  • Experience using SAP preferred.
  • Experience using Blackline JE and Reconciliation Software.
  • Proficient in Microsoft Word, Excel, and PowerPoint.

Travel:

  • Occasional travel to Home Office in San Carlos.

Salary Range: $111,800.00 - $151,800.00 annually

BeOne is committed to fair and equitable compensation practices. Actual compensation packages are determined by several factors that are unique to each candidate, including but not limited to job-related skills, depth of experience, certifications, relevant education or training, and specific work location. Packages may vary by location due to differences in the cost of labor. The recruiter can share more about the specific salary range for a preferred location during the hiring process.  Please note that the listed range reflects the base salary or hourly range only. Non-Commercial roles are eligible to participate in the annual bonus plan, and Commercial roles are eligible to participate in an incentive compensation plan. All Company employees have the opportunity to own shares of BeOne Medicines Ltd. stock because all employees are eligible for discretionary equity awards and to voluntarily participate in the Employee Stock Purchase Plan. The Company has a comprehensive benefits package that includes Medical, Dental, Vision, 401(k), FSA/HSA, Life Insurance, Paid Time Off, and Wellness.
